Target Opens 45 Stores, But Plans To Open Additional At Slower Pace


(Filed Under Fashion News). Target Corp. opened 45 Target stores earlier this month in various states including Alaska, Connecticut, Georgia, South Dakota, Michigan, Wisconsin, Minnesota and Virginia.

Target also reported it would open new stores at a slower pace in fiscal 2009 and 2010. The company has plans to open 70 net stores next year-a bit below Target's annual average of 90 to 100 stores.

Target announced that its same-store sales for September fell 3 percent and that third quarter profits may be below Wall Street estimates. Target's competitor, Wal-Mart, reported a 17 percent increase in second quarter profit.

Target will report its third quarter earnings next month.
